As I outlined in last weeks post, we kicked off our teaching series about who Church At Barking Riverside are, in our Sunday Celebration on Sunday just gone. Sam did a great talk on setting the scene, highlighting the fact that the reason why we exist as a church, why we do what we do (hubs, celebrations, community events), are all because we are joining in with what Jesus is already doing here in Barking Riverside. Though we are a church plant, we haven’t just started a church, brought some existing church goers to fill our Sunday Celebrations and asked people in our community to join us. We have come here to embody what Jesus calls us to do: to follow Him, share the Word and help create disciples.
We want to see Barking Riverside thrive with Jesus at the heart…

We are not defined by a church building or the numbers of people who attend our celebrations and events. We are church. We are a group of people who have chosen to not only hear His call to follow Him, but to help spread the Word and His love to all we meet. That includes our community, no matter our age, creed, colour or religion. Which is just as well, considering the diverse area we are serving in. So it is up to all of us to pray for discernment for what He would really like us to focus on this year that will help reach and support everyone within Barking Riverside.
But in the meantime, we are talking loud and clear about how we really put wanting to see Jesus at the heart into practice. We use our Habits (how we create space for Jesus in our daily lives), Hubs (who we do it with) and Hands (where we do it and who we do it for) to help keep ourselves and each other accountable for making time for Jesus in our everyday lives.
